[MASOCH-L] CRM114 ou OSBF-Lua?

Julio Covolato julio at psi.com.br
Wed Feb 21 14:59:22 BRST 2007


Na última versão do osbf-lua o header "X-OSBF-Lua-Score" não possui mais 
"[--]" e sim "[S]". Uso o seguinte no meu .mailfilter:

-----------------------------------8<--------------------------------
import SENDER
import RECIPIENT
import EXTENSION
#LOGDIR="/var/log"
#logfile "$LOGDIR/maildrop.log"
maildirmake=/usr/local/bin/maildirmake
MAILDIR=$DEFAULT
# Config da pasta Spam
JUNK_FOLDER=.Spam
_JUNK_DEST=$MAILDIR/$JUNK_FOLDER/
# Config para OSBF-LUA
OSBF_LUA_DIR=/usr/local/osbf-lua
OSBF_LUA_USER_DIR=$HOME/osbf-lua
#######################################################
# Criação automática da pasta .Spam
`test -d $_JUNK_DEST`
if ($RETURNCODE != 0 )
{
        `$maildirmake $_JUNK_DEST`
# auto subscribe da pasta .Spam (funciona com o courier imap)
        `echo INBOX$JUNK_FOLDER >> $MAILDIR/courierimapsubscribed`
}
# Raramente spam é mair do que 350 kb:
if ( $SIZE < 350000 )
{
   exception {
   xfilter "$OSBF_LUA_DIR/spamfilter.lua --udir $OSBF_LUA_USER_DIR"
   }
}
if ( /^X-OSBF-Lua-Score:.*\[[S]\] /:h )
{
        exception {
                to "$_JUNK_DEST"
        }
}
-----------------------------------------------8<------------------------------------------

Abraços,
-----------------------------
    _    Julio Cesar Covolato
   0v0   <julio at psi.com.br>
  /(_)\  F: 55-11-3129-3366
   ^ ^   PSI INTERNET
-----------------------------



Filipe Alvarez wrote:
> Obrigado, vou testar!
>
> Em 09/02/07, Cassiano Aquino <caquino at ebrain.com.br> escreveu:
>   
>> Ola Felipe,
>>
>> Basicamente voce poderia usar algo assim:
>>
>> SHELL="/bin/sh"
>> import MAILDIRQUOTA
>> import HOME
>> import EXT
>> import HOST
>> import USER
>> OSBF_LUA_DIR=/usr/share/osbf-lua
>> OSBF_LUA_USER_DIR="${HOME}osbf-lua"
>>
>> exception {
>>                 xfilter "$OSBF_LUA_DIR/spamfilter.lua --gdir
>> $OSBF_LUA_DIR/ --udir $OSBF_LUA_USER_DIR/"
>> }
>>
>> if ( /^X-OSBF-Lua-Score:.*\[[--]\] /:h )
>> {
>>         exception {
>>                 to "Maildir/.SPAM.E Spam/"
>>         }
>> }
>>
>>     
> __
> masoch-l list
> https://eng.registro.br/mailman/listinfo/masoch-l
>   


More information about the masoch-l mailing list